In this tutorial, we discuss several practical issues regarding speci cation and solution of dependability and performability models. We compare model types with and without rewards. Continuous-time Markov chains (CTMCs) are compared with (continuous-time) Markov reward models (MRMs) and generalized stochastic Petri nets (GSPNs) are compared with stochastic reward nets (SRNs). It is shown that reward-based models could lead to more concise model speci cation and solution of a variety of new measures. With respect to the solution of dependability and performability models, we identify three practical issues: largeness, sti ness, and non-exponentiality, and we discuss a variety of approaches to deal with them, including some of the latest research e orts.
